We are in the mentor matching cycle for the second PreSEED term. So far,
48 out of the 52 are matched (92%) since the cycle started on 5 May. This
term officially starts in June and runs through December 2008. The newly
matched mentors are now having their preliminary meetings with the mentee’s
managers and the mentor-mentee pairs are going through their two hour
training sessions as those are scheduled.
The SEED program is also now accepting applications from Sun Engineering
staff worldwide for its Recent Hire and Established Staff terms which
will start in September 2008. (The next PreSEED term does not start until
January 2009.)
To date, we have 47 SEED applications, 8 of which
are complete. All materials are due by 9 June. SEED has applications
from Sun Engineering staff working in Czech Republic, India, Ireland,
Israel, Italy, the Netherlands, P.R. China, Russia, Saudi Arabia,
Switzerland, Taiwan, the UK, and the USA. They work for Sun Labs, Microelectronics,
Global Sales and Services, Software, Storage, Systems, and Worldwide Operations.
